Steenburgen won the Academy Award for the category of Best Supporting Actress and also the Golden Globe Award . [20] In September 2005, she and Danson gave a guest lecture for students at the Clinton School of Public Service where they discussed their roles in public service as well as the foundations and causes in which they are involved. Although Steenburgen didnt know how to play an instrument at the time, she learned and then wrote 12 songs and sent them to a music lawyer. [23], Since 2014, Steenburgen's son Charlie McDowell has had a running joke at her expense, claiming on numerous occasions on social media that his mother is actress Andie MacDowell. [11], In 2018, her composition "Glasgow (No Place Like Home)" as performed by Jessie Buckley featured as the climactic musical moment in the film Wild Rose and won Steenburgen several awards, including Critics Choice Award. Actress Mary Steenburgen happily accepts an Academy Award for her supporting role in 'Melvin and Howard' during the 53rd Academy Awards held on March 31, 1981. In her third movie, Melvin and Howard (1980), Steenburgens performance as the winsome go-go dancer married to the hapless dreamer Melvin Dummar (played by Paul Le Mat) won her both a Golden Globe Award and an Academy Award as best supporting actress. Her mother, Nellie May (Wall) Steenburgen, was a school-board secretary, and her father, Maurice H. Steenburgen, was a freight-train conductor. Steenburgen said that her new musical abilities were a bizarre and at first, annoying and scary side effect of her surgery. In 1972, she moved to Manhattan after the Neighborhood Playhouse offered her an opportunity to study acting.
